A similar story: my brother was bottom fishing with some guys at the South end of Revillagigedo Channel (near Ketchikan). Three of them caught lots of fish, one hardly any, until he did. They fought it for an hour or more taking turns, into dark thirty. When the halibut finally started coming up, Jerry (my bro) was leaning over the side, ready to gaff it. When it came into view he said it was like a truck coming at him. Their boat was already pretty full of fish, so somehow they managed to tow the halibut slowly back to the NOAA (mother) ship coming in way late, and they winched it aboard. If I recall correctly they estimated it as well over 300#. And then the ships crew saw all the fish in the boat. “Where in the hell were you?!!”
That was in the late 70s.
